Rangemaster is Britain's oldest and most renowned manufacturer of range cookers, with a history dating back to 1830. The brand is famous for inventing the world's first range cooker, known as the Kitchener, produced in its long-standing factory in Leamington Spa, Warwickshire. This facility remains the primary manufacturing hub where most Rangemaster products are still hand-finished today, maintaining a heritage of British engineering and craftsmanship.
Over the decades, the brand evolved through various ownerships, most notably as part of the Aga Rangemaster Group. In 2015, the brand was acquired by Middleby Corporation, an American global leader in the commercial and residential foodservice equipment industry. Despite this American ownership, Rangemaster continues to be positioned as a premium British brand, focusing on high-quality kitchen appliances including ovens, hobs, and refrigerators for the global market.
